The average CEO (Mid-Market) salary in Connecticut is $616,200 per year as of 2026, based on projections from BLS Occupational Employment Statistics. The 25th percentile sits at $468,300 and the 75th at $801,000.
Pay-wise, Connecticut sits +21% above the national CEO (Mid-Market) median ($509,200). That makes it one of the stronger markets — though cost of living should always be factored in alongside raw salary.
Senior CEO (Mid-Market)s (10–14 years of experience) in Connecticut earn around $739,400 per year on average. Veterans with 15+ years can reach $838,000 or more, especially at the 75th percentile and above.
Among all 51 jurisdictions (50 states + DC), Connecticut ranks 7th for CEO (Mid-Market) pay. The highest-paying state pays around $738,400 on average.
